Filter Datas

Ola, alguem poderia me ajudar com minha duvida?

Tenho diversas colunas de dados no meu formulario, por exemplo, dados de criacao da solicitacao e data agendada, no meu dashboard, gostaria de poder alterar a visualizacao dos dados entre esses dois dados, por exemplo, se eu clicar em um, ele extrai como dados da "data de criacao" e se eu clicar no outro filtro, ele puxa a coluna "data agendada" coluna, existe uma maneira de fazer isso? nao encontrei em lugar nenhum

Hi @CarlosAfonso ,

You can use the bookmarks and buttons feature in Power BI to switch between different views (visibility).

Set up two views for the data in the report: one using the creation date and the other using the scheduled date. Create two bookmarks to save the visual visibility state. Insert two buttons in the report, each corresponding to a date type. Select the appropriate bookmark for each button. When clicking each button, the report should switch to the view using the other date column.
